B-52 Data Interface Unit/Data Transfer Receptacle (DTR)
Contract Opportunity Analysis
The Department of the Air Force is conducting market research to identify potential sources capable of repairing the B-52 Data Interface Unit/Data Transfer Receptacle. The required scope of work encompasses hardware repairs, obsolete parts resolution, and engineering support for Deficiency Reports and Diminishing Manufacturing Sources and Material Shortages. Because the government currently lacks the technical data and rights to compete this repair, interested contractors may need to use reverse engineering or other techniques to obtain the necessary technical data for this critical Line Replaceable Unit.
